About The/Nudge:
The/Nudge is an action institute working towards a poverty-free India, within our lifetime. We partner with governments, markets, and civil society to build resilient livelihoods for all. We are a collective of some of India’s best leaders and entrepreneurs from across the industry, academia, government, and development sectors, and our work is organized across three impact streams:
Centre for Skill Development & Entrepreneurship (CSDE): exists to enable underprivileged youth to lead flourishing lives
Centre for Rural Development (CRD): exists to enable families to come out of extreme poverty
Centre for Social Innovation (CSI): exists to nudge top talent to solve India’s biggest challenge
About The/Nudge Prize:
The/Nudge Prize is a platform to draw talent, capital, and public attention towards the most pressing developmental problems in India. The/Nudge Prize is part of the CSI impact stream and is a strategic partner to build a thriving livelihood ecosystem across India's social landscape.
The/Nudge Prize aims to guide markets where they are needed the most.
By inducing population scale solutions & innovations that have disproportionate impact on stagnant livelihood opportunities & ecosystems for underserved segments.
We research, design & conduct ‘tech based scale-up competitions’, to discover/innovate disruptive solutions and pull in capital to solve the most complex problems in India, faster.
This role is to lead the DCM Shriram AgWater Challenge - one of India’s first challenges/competitions to induce solutions that improve agricultural water use & smallholder farmer’s livelihoods.
